Health Professions Degrees Available at Surry Community College

Here is each degree level offered in health professions at Surry Community College,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Associate’s 55
Undergraduate Certificate 23
Certificate 40

Surry Community College Health Professions Associate’s Degrees

In the most recent year for which we have data, Surry Community College awarded 55 associate’s degrees in health professions.

Associate’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 7% of health professions associate’s degrees went to men and 93% went to women.

Surry Community College gender breakdown of Health Professions Associate's degree grads The majority of health professions associate’s degree graduates at Surry Community College were White. About 82%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Surry Community College with a associate’s in health professions.

Ethnic diversity of Health Professions majors at Surry Community College
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 4
White 45
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 4

Registered Nursing/Registered Nurse (Associate’s)

Surry Community College conferred 40 associate’s degrees in registered nursing/registered nurse in the most recent reporting year — 95% to women and 5%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(80%).

Physical Therapy Assistant (Associate’s)

Surry Community College awarded 6 associate’s degrees in physical therapy assistant recently — 83% to women and 17%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(83%).

Medical Office Management/Administration (Associate’s)

Surry Community College awarded 6 associate’s degrees in medical office management/administration in the most recent reporting year — 100% to women and 0%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(83%).

Emergency Medical Technology/Technician (EMT Paramedic) (Associate’s)

Surry Community College awarded 2 associate’s completions in emergency medical technology/technician (emt paramedic) in the most recent reporting year — 50% to women and 50%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(100%).

Pre-Nursing Studies (Associate’s)

Surry Community College conferred 1 associate’s completion in pre-nursing studies in the latest year of data — 100% to women and 0%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(100%).
